James Oliver as Charlie Dexton in Black Crescent Moon 2009
Caption: James Oliver as Charlie Dexton in Black Crescent Moon 2009
Source: IMDB
Jay Kim pictures →
Patrick Weil pictures →
Pierce Brosnan pictures →